The effects of particulate cow bone additions on the mechanical properties and thermal properties of cow bone particle reinforced and polyester matrix composite was evaluated to assess the possibility of using it as a new material engineering application. Cow bone particles reinforced with recycled low density polyester were prepared by varying the cow bone particles from 80%-20%, 70%-30% and 60%-40% of polyester and bone powder ratio by using hand layup compression method. The mechanical properties of the developed composite were investigated. Factorial design experiment was conducted as per standard high thermal capacity material, with a view to investigate which of the design impacts strength. The study revealed that the additions of the particulate cow bone have the most significant main effect on the wear behavior of the. Hence, cow bone particles can be used to improve the strength and wear properties of polyester matrix composite material.
